Adjustable pitch rotor for milling applications
An adjustable pitch rotor for a milling machine includes an inner drum and an outer shell formed by first and second outer shell portions. Drum cutting assemblies with cutting bits extend outward from outer surfaces of the outer shell portions, with each of the cutting bits being longitudinally spaced from longitudinally adjacent cutting bits on their respective outer shell portions by a pitch distance. In a first pitch configuration, each cutting bit may be longitudinally aligned with a corresponding cutting bit on the other outer shell portion so that grooves milled in a work surface by the rotor are spaced by the pitch distance. In a second pitch configuration, each of the cutting bits may be longitudinally spaced from longitudinally adjacent cutting bits of the other outer shell portion by one-half the pitch distance to mill grooves in the work surface that are spaced by one-half the pitch distance.
